How many Sans Blue commanders are tracked?

Playgroup.gg tracks 3 Sans Blue commanders with at least 15 recorded games and at least 4 distinct registered pilots in the last 90 days. The pilot diversity floor stops a single grinder from skewing the ranking with their pet deck.

How are Sans Blue commander rankings calculated?

Rankings use pod-size-normalized win rates from games tracked through the Playgroup.gg app. A win in a 2-player game and a win in a 5-player game are weighted fairly against the 25% expected baseline for 4-player Commander.

How often is the Sans Blue data updated?

Stats refresh every 6 hours. The last 90 days window means rankings shift gradually as new games are recorded and older games age out of the window.
